If you are forced to abandon ship in a rescue boat, you should _______________.

A vote on what to do, so all hands will have a part in the decision
B remain in the immediate vicinity
C head for the nearest land
D head for the closest sea lanes
AI Explanation

The correct answer is B) remain in the immediate vicinity. When abandoning a ship in a rescue boat, the primary objective is to remain close to the sinking vessel in case rescue efforts are required. Staying in the immediate vicinity allows rescue personnel to more easily locate and retrieve the occupants of the rescue boat. The other options are not recommended, as heading for land or sea lanes could take the rescue boat too far away from the site of the emergency, potentially delaying or complicating the rescue operation. Voting on what to do is also not the appropriate course of action in an emergency situation where quick decision-making is crucial.
